1. Missing, Cracked, or Curling Shingles
Shingles are your roof's armor. When they start to fail, your entire home becomes vulnerable. Missing shingles create openings for water infiltration, while cracked or curling shingles indicate age-related deterioration or wind damage.
What to look for:
- Bare spots where shingles are completely missing
- Visible cracks running through shingles
- Edges curling upward (cupping) or downward (clawing)
- Granule loss leaving dark spots on shingles
In South Florida's intense sun and frequent storms, asphalt shingles can deteriorate faster than in other climates. If you notice widespread shingle damage affecting more than 25% of your roof, it's time to consider professional roof replacement.
2.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ains are perhaps the most obvious sign of a roofing problem. These yellowish-brown discolorations on your ceiling or walls indicate that water is penetrating your roof system and entering your home's interior.
Even small water stains shouldn't be ignored. What starts as a minor leak can quickly escalate into major structural damage, mold growth, and compromised insulation. The source of the leak may be far from where the stain appears, as water can travel along rafters before dripping down.
Action steps:
- Document the location and size of all water stains
- Check your attic for signs of water intrusion during and after rainfall
- Schedule a professional roof inspection immediately
3. Sagging Roof Deck
A sagging roof deck is a serious structural issue that requires immediate attention. This problem occurs when the underlying roof structure weakens due to prolonged moisture exposure, excessive weight, or age-related deterioration.
Look at your roofline from the street or yard. A healthy roof should have straight, even lines. Any sagging, dipping, or irregular appearance indicates structural compromise that could lead to catastrophic failure if not addressed promptly.
Warning: A sagging roof deck is not a DIY project. This issue requires professional assessment to determine if structural repairs or complete roof replacement is necessary.
4. Excessive Granule Loss
Asphalt shingles are coated with protective granules that shield against UV rays and weather damage. As shingles age, they naturally shed some granules, but excessive loss is a red flag.
How to identify granule loss:
- Check gutters and downspouts for accumulation of granules (they look like coarse sand)
- Look for dark, smooth patches on shingles where granules are missing
- Observe if granule loss is uniform across the roof or concentrated in specific areas
Significant granule loss means your shingles are approaching the end of their lifespan. Without that protective coating, the underlying asphalt becomes vulnerable to sun damage and weathering, accelerating deterioration.
5. Daylight Visible Through Roof Boards
If you can see daylight through your roof boards when you're in the attic, you have serious openings in your roof system. This is one of the most critical warning signs because it means water, pests, and outside air are freely entering your home.
While in your attic, also check for:
- Moisture or water staining on roof boards
- Mold or mildew growth
- Compressed or wet insulation
- Musty odors indicating ongoing moisture problems
